CYYR1  -  cysteine/tyrosine-rich 1

Homo sapiens

Synonyms: C21orf95, Cysteine and tyrosine-rich protein 1, Proline-rich domain-containing protein

Analytical, diagnostic and therapeutic context of CYYR1

  • The CYYR1 messenger RNA was found by Northern blot analysis in a broad range of tissues (two transcripts of 3.4 and 2.2 kb) [1].
